Our Enforcement Officers play a big part in clamping untaxed vehicles on behalf of the DVLA

Your day starts with a briefing from your manager and making sure you've got everything you need for the day ahead You'll drive one of our specialist ANPR vehicles which will locate untaxed vehicles on public highways as you drive by. You will then be responsible for making sure any vehicles flagged are clamped and dealt with in the right way

Dealing with members of the public is a big part of the role, sometimes in difficult circumstances, so you must be a great communicator.
